The property is a detached, 1930s Cheshire red-brick home with a contemporary design. The entrance hall features a recessed ceiling, underfloor heating, and a log burner, with a part-tiled cloakroom and utility room nearby. The home has a large, open-plan kitchen-dining-living room with sliding doors, large windows, and a minimalist recessed fireplace. The kitchen features tall, grey cabinetry, integrated appliances, and a central island breakfast bar with seating. The living area has a coffered ceiling and a log-burning stove, while the formal dining space has a seamless flow out onto the porcelain terrace. The home has a mature garden to the rear, with a glazed door and a bespoke dog shower in the utility room.
